monitorlg Posted March 17, 2009 Share Posted March 17, 2009 Hi All, I want to add images to the tree view.... It should only be added to the items in the tree view,it should not be there for the subitems... Can anybody help me.. Does anybody have a sample script for it.. Thanks in advance. Zedna Posted March 18, 2009 Share Posted March 18, 2009 (edited) Example from helpfile for _GUICtrlTreeView_SetImageIndex() expandcollapse popup#AutoIt3Wrapper_au3check_parameters=-d -w 1 -w 2 -w 3 -w 4 -w 5 -w 6#include <GuiConstantsEx.au3> #include <GuiTreeView.au3> #include <GuiImageList.au3> #include <WindowsConstants.au3> Opt('MustDeclareVars', 1) $Debug_TV = False ; Check ClassName being passed to functions, set to True and use a handle to another control to see it work _Main() Func _Main() Local $hItem[6], $hImage, $hRandomImage, $hRandomItem, $hTreeView Local $iStyle = BitOR($TVS_EDITLABELS, $TVS_HASBUTTONS, $TVS_HASLINES, $TVS_LINESATROOT, $TVS_DISABLEDRAGDROP, $TVS_SHOWSELALWAYS, $TVS_CHECKBOXES) GUICreate("TreeView Set Image Index", 400, 300) $hTreeView = GUICtrlCreateTreeView(2, 2, 396, 268, $iStyle, $WS_EX_CLIENTEDGE) GUISetState() $hImage = _GUIImageList_Create(16, 16, 5, 3) _GUIImageList_AddIcon($hImage, "shell32.dll", 110) _GUIImageList_AddIcon($hImage, "shell32.dll", 131) _GUIImageList_AddIcon($hImage, "shell32.dll", 165) _GUIImageList_AddIcon($hImage, "shell32.dll", 168) _GUIImageList_AddIcon($hImage, "shell32.dll", 137) _GUIImageList_AddIcon($hImage, "shell32.dll", 146) _GUIImageList_AddIcon($hImage, "shell32.dll", 3) _GUICtrlTreeView_SetNormalImageList($hTreeView, $hImage) _GUICtrlTreeView_BeginUpdate($hTreeView) For $x = 0 To UBound($hItem) - 1 $hRandomImage = Random(0, 5, 1) $hItem[$x] = _GUICtrlTreeView_Add($hTreeView, 0, StringFormat("[%02d] New Item", $x + 1), $hRandomImage, $hRandomImage) Next _GUICtrlTreeView_EndUpdate($hTreeView) $hRandomItem = Random(0, UBound($hItem) - 1, 1) MsgBox(4160, "Information", StringFormat("Item %d Image Index? %s", $hRandomItem, _GUICtrlTreeView_GetImageIndex($hTreeView, $hItem[$hRandomItem]))) _GUICtrlTreeView_SetImageIndex($hTreeView, $hItem[$hRandomItem], 6) MsgBox(4160, "Information", StringFormat("Item %d Image Index? %s", $hRandomItem, _GUICtrlTreeView_GetImageIndex($hTreeView, $hItem[$hRandomItem]))) ; Loop until user exits Do Until GUIGetMsg() = $GUI_EVENT_CLOSE GUIDelete() EndFunc ;==>_Main Note: also look at _GUICtrlTreeView_Level() to distinguish root/child level of items This can be start point for you ...
